For this unit, we had to choose a piece of artwork from the North Carolina Museum of Art and create another piece inspired by that piece. The artwork that I chose was called "Judith and Holofernes," by Kehinde Wiley. It depicted an African American woman holding the decapitated head of a white woman, which I thought was a really interesting concept for a painting. I combined it with the idea of an Audobon painting to create my piece. Kehinde Wiley depicted a powerful yet graceful woman in his painting, which is what I wanted to do with mine. In my painting, the woman appears to be graceful, as shown in her clothing and her hair, but she has an air of power around her by standing next to a majestic bird like a peacock. The background of my painting was also inspired by Kehinde Wiley's paintings, with a colorful floral pattern.
